Texmaker is a free LaTeX editor, that integrates many tools needed to develop documents with LaTeX, in just one application.
Features:
a unicode editor to write your LaTeX source files (syntax highlighting, undo-redo, search-replace, spell checker...)
the principal LaTex tags can be inserted directly with the "LaTeX" and "Math" menus
370 mathematical symbols can be inserted in just one click
wizards to generate code (´Quick document´, ´Quick letter´, tabular, tabbing and array environments)
LaTeX-related programs can be launched via the "Tools" menu
the standard Bibtex entry types can be inserted in the ".bib" file with the "Bibliography" menu
a "structure view" of the document for easier navigation of a document (by clicking on an item in the "Structure" frame, you can jump directly to the corresponding part of your document
extensive LaTeX documentation
in the "Messages / Log File" frame, you can see information about processes and the logfile after a LaTeX compilation
the "Next Latex Error" and "Previous Latex Error" commands let you reach the LaTeX errors detected in the log file
by clicking on the number of a line in the log file, the cursor jumps to the corresponding line in the editor
an integrated LaTeX to html conversion tool
What´s New in version 4.0.2:
High-dpi screen support has been added on MacOsX Lion for the pdf viewer, the symbols and the toolbars icons (because of a Qt 5 limitation, icons are still pixelized in the 'push buttons' and in the menus for the moment)
structure tags (chapter, section, ...) are now totally boldified in the editor
the 'regular expression' option is no more checked by default in the 'replace' widget.
on linux, session file is no more stored in the temp/ directory (some linux distribution reset this directory at each reboot), but in the 'home/.cache' directory.
detection of acrobat reader 11 and ghostscript 9.07 has been added (for new users)
windows versions are now compiled with Qt 5.0.2 (the Qt bug about the save file dialog has been fixed in this Qt release)
